The Razer Viper V2 Pro Hyperspeed is a renewed ultra-lightweight wireless gaming mouse featuring a 58g design, a cutting-edge 30K DPI Focus Pro optical sensor, and Gen-3 optical switches rated for 90 million clicks. Its HyperSpeed wireless technology delivers 25% faster connection speeds for lag-free competitive play, backed by an impressive 80-hour battery life and on-mouse DPI controls for seamless customization.

Scroll wheel quit working after 1 month
The mouse is nice, lightweight and responsive. Battery seems to be in good shape, connected seamlessly. I didn't realize the DPI button was the same button as the power button and that it was on the bottom, so that's something to consider if you like to switch sensitivity on the fly. The main negative issue is that despite being listed as having all accessories/box/manual and being a complete product, the unit I received did not have the grip tape. Edit: One month later the scroll wheel stopped working correctly, when you scroll it either will reverse direction or skip the input, apparently this is a known problem and I wish I'd known before buying. If you ever use the scroll wheel for anything, I would avoid this mouse.

Questionable Durability for the Price Point
I had this mouse for about a year and a half and during that period, the mouse functioned flawlessly. It's a super light mouse and it glides really well so it was easy to use. However, I don't really use the PC for anything other than gaming and I typically play with a controller so the mouse didn't get much use. With that in mind, the mouse still failed after a year and a half where the scroll wheel no longer functioned properly, rendering the mouse useless. After doing some research, I learned the scroll wheel is a common failure point in these razer mice. Overall, I wouldn't spend the money on this mouse again, but it was nice while it functioned.
